On Fri, Jun 28, 2024 at 07:05:07PM +0530, Geetha sowjanya wrote:
> This series adds representor support for each rvu devices.
> When switchdev mode is enabled, representor netdev is registered
> for each rvu device. In implementation of representor model,
> one NIX HW LF with multiple SQ and RQ is reserved, where each
> RQ and SQ of the LF are mapped to a representor. A loopback channel
> is reserved to support packet path between representors and VFs.
> CN10K silicon supports 2 types of MACs, RPM and SDP. This
> patch set adds representor support for both RPM and SDP MAC
> interfaces.

> Command to create VF representor
> #devlink dev eswitch set pci/0002:1c:00.0 mode switchdev
> VF representors are created for each VF when switch mode is set switchdev on representor PCI device
Does it mean that VFs needs to be created before going to switchdev
mode? (in legacy mode). Keep in mind that in both mellanox and ice
driver assume that VFs are created after chaning mode to switchdev (mode
can't be changed if VFs).
Different order can be problematic. For example (AFAIK) kubernetes
scripts for switchdev assume that first is switching to switchdev and
VFs creation is done after that.
